Plot Summary

This documentary explores Hector Berlioz's monumental Symphonie Fantastique and his rarely performed Messe Solennelle. It delves into the historical context, musical innovations, and enduring legacy of these two ambitious works. Through archival footage, expert interviews, and performance excerpts, the film brings these masterpieces to life for a modern audience.

Fun Fact

The Orchestre Révolutionnaire et Romantique, featured in this documentary, is known for its use of period instruments, aiming to recreate the sound of Berlioz's era.
